Are Co-ords On Trend in 2026?

Author: Stylist at TellarDate: 2025

Yes, co-ords are absolutely on trend for 2026 and showing no signs of slowing down. After dominating wardrobes since 2023, matching sets have evolved from pandemic comfort wear into sophisticated, versatile pieces that fashion insiders can't get enough of. This year, we're seeing co-ords reinvented with elevated fabrics, unexpected silhouettes, and styling tricks that make them feel fresh and modern rather than overly matchy-matchy.

Why Co-ords Continue to Rule in 2026

As someone who's styled countless clients over the years, I can tell you that co-ords solve multiple wardrobe dilemmas simultaneously. They take the guesswork out of getting dressed, offer incredible versatility when pieces are worn separately, and provide that effortlessly put-together look we're all chasing. In 2026, the trend has matured beautifully—we're moving away from obvious loungewear sets towards more sophisticated interpretations that work from boardroom to brunch.

The key trends I'm seeing this year include textured knits, tailored blazer and trouser combinations, and those gorgeous flowing sets in luxe fabrics like silk and modal. The colour palette has shifted towards rich, earthy tones—think burnt orange, deep forest green, and warm camel—alongside classic neutrals that never date.

How to Style Co-ords Like a Pro

The secret to wearing co-ords without looking like you've rolled out of bed? It's all about the styling details. I always tell my clients to treat each piece as a separate entity first. Can you pair that knitted top with your favourite jeans? Does the matching trouser work with a crisp white shirt? If yes, you've found a winner.

For daytime, try breaking up a matching set with a contrasting blazer or cardigan. Add structured accessories—a leather belt, pointed-toe flats, or a structured handbag. For evening, lean into the coordinated look but elevate with statement jewellery, heels, and a sleek clutch. The trick is adding one or two elements that feel deliberately styled rather than accidentally matched.

Styling for Different Body Shapes

The beauty of co-ords lies in finding the right silhouette for your body. If you're petite, look for cropped tops and high-waisted bottoms to elongate your legs. For curvier figures, I recommend sets with defined waists—either through tailoring or belting. If you're tall, you can carry off longer, flowing styles beautifully. The key is ensuring the proportions work for your frame rather than fighting against it.

Seasonal Transitions

Spring 2026 co-ords are all about lighter fabrics and fresh colours. Think linen blends, cotton knits, and those gorgeous pastel shades that make everything feel optimistic. Layer with denim jackets or lightweight cardigans for unpredictable weather. Summer calls for breathable fabrics and more relaxed silhouettes—perfect for holiday packing as they create multiple outfits from fewer pieces.
